saytime − audio time check
saytime [ −ch ] [ −d dir ] [ −f fmt ] [ −o dev ]
saytime speaks the current time through the computer’s sound device.
−v lvl |
Set volume level. |
||
−r sec |
Repeat at the specified interval in background mode. |
||
−c |
Output to stdout. |
||
−d dir |
Use sounds from alternate directory (default /usr/share/saytime). |
||
−f fmt |
Specify format of time message. (see FORMAT STRING below). |
||
−h |
Display simple help. |
||
−o dev |
Output to alternate file (default /dev/audio). |
A format string can be specified to control the time message. Valid format characters are:
%k |
hour, 24-hour clock (00..23) |
|||
%l |
hour, 12-hour clock (01..12) |
|||
%M |
minutes |
|||
%P |
Introductory phrase (’The time is’) |
|||
%S |
seconds |
